Most Affordable Neighborhoods in Kissimmee, FL
Some of the cheapest neighborhoods in Kissimmee are Whispering Oaks, Shadow Bay, and Venetian Bay. These neighborhoods offer some of the lowest rent prices in Kissimmee, making them ideal for renters on a budget. As of June 23, 2025, the average rent in Kissimmee is $1,561, which is 2.4% lower than last year. However, it's important to remember that rental prices can vary significantly based on factors such as location, amenities, and floor plans.

Downtown Kissimmee is known for its historic charm, featuring a mix of family-owned shops and dining spots along Main, Broadway, and Emmet streets. The neighborhood is highly walkable, allowing residents to easily explore local attractions. Lake Tohopekaliga, commonly known as Lake Toho, offers various outdoor activities, including walking paths, a fishing pier, and picnic areas at the Kissimmee Lakefront Park.

Methodology
Transit Score measures access to public transit. Scores range from 0 (minimal transit) to 100 (rider’s paradise). Learn more about the Transit Score methodology. Rental data is sourced from CoStar Group’s Market Trend reports.
